Definitions and Meaning of motto in English

Wordnet

motto (n)

a favorite saying of a sect or political group

Webster

motto (n.)

A sentence, phrase, or word, forming part of an heraldic achievment.

A sentence, phrase, or word, prefixed to an essay, discourse, chapter, canto, or the like, suggestive of its subject matter; a short, suggestive expression of a guiding principle; a maxim.
